Defects of natural language
Modern logic, as a tool to analyze natural language, thinks that the defects of natural language are: (1) the hierarchical structure of expression is not clear enough; (2) Individualized cognitive model is not clear enough; (3) The jurisdiction of quantifiers is not exact; (4) The word order of sentence components is not fixed; (5) Form and semantics do not correspond.
Judging logical language from the perspective of natural language has the following shortcomings: (1) The types of initial words are not diverse enough; (2) There are fewer kinds of quantifiers; (3) The range of quantifiers in the formula series cannot be dynamically expanded; (4) Due to the lack of context, language is inefficient in conveying information.
